Sustainability and Culture & Art

Within the scope of the 'Contemporary Art and Curatorship' Seminar Program, Özlem Ece, The Director of the IKSV Cultural Policy Studies Department, will do a seminar on the "Sustainability and Culture & Art" based on the culture and art policies report published by IKSV on April 19, 2021.

The world of culture and arts, which has a strong commitment to change against the ecological crisis that threatens the present and future of the planet we live in, also feels the responsibility to transform its own practices. For this reason, providing conditions for creative voices to be louder and providing tools to aid transformation is one of the most pressing issues of cultural politics.

In this seminar entitled "Sustainability and Culture & Art"; The things that can be done for ecological transformation in the field of culture and arts will be opened to discussion through new insights and practices inspired by the climate movement. Green tools that can help culture and arts actors who want to take concrete steps in this way are offered by Assoc. Dr. Hande Paker.  It will be presented based on the report titled “Culture and Art for Ecological Transformation” prepared by Hande Paker.

About Özlem ECE

Özlem Ece is the director of İKSV Cultural Policy Studies department since its establishment in 2010.

Özlem completed her bachelor’s degree in Public Administration in French at Marmara University and her master’s degree in Cultural Projects Management at Grenoble Institute of Political Studies. Between 2003 and 2008, she worked as project director and communication consultant on local, national and international projects in some of the most prestigious cultural institutions in Turkey. Throughout 2008, she worked as the General Coordinator of “Cultural Season of Turkey in France”, a project which was realised under the auspices of Turkish and French Ministries of Foreign Affairs and Culture and in collaboration with CulturesFrance.

Ece, who continues to design projects and publications on cultural policy and cultural management, is also a member of UNESCO Turkish National Commission’s Committee of Diversity of Cultural Expressions. She is a member of the advisory boards of WOW (Women of the World) Istanbul Festival and Istanbul Metropolitan Municipality Arts and Culture Platform.
